Transaction 56d1179a965e0335b140d1aaa3368aed49056aa493edf3257c0daad984372974

7 Input
2 Outputs
  • 56d1179a965e0335b140d1aaa3368aed49056aa493edf3257c0daad984372974:0
  • value  994639
    address  39y7RMaEn4FEVnuovS1ZRLmpBqybKE13tE
  • 56d1179a965e0335b140d1aaa3368aed49056aa493edf3257c0daad984372974:1
  • value  48523814
    address  1MT8pTj2W4FCa4Bz6mbxcLRckJGfaB2n1a